Psychotherapist Job Description

A psychotherapist works with clients on achieving and maintaining a desirable mental health.

The psychotherapist helps clients achieve psychological well-being by assessing and treating mental disorders and by teaching individuals how to maintain mental health.

In this capacity, the psychotherapist has a high level of autonomy and independence.

The psychotherapist’s professional position entails taking on a wider range of therapeutic activities than is practiced in a psychoanalyst’s office.

The psychotherapist’s skills are largely based on an understanding of psychopathology and a strong grasp of the psychological and social issues that guide individual behavior.
